UTCJ THEOREMA Revista científica PDF THEOREMA 5 OK | Page 82

demás. Después que se finaliza la creación de las tablas y sus relacio- nes, DBDesigner4 puede exportar el esquema de la base de datos en un archivo del tipo SQL” (Carvajal, 2011). Una vez creado el diseño de la base de datos se procede a generar el código SQL para crear la base de datos en el gestor de base de datos MYSQL, para hacer uso del gestor mencionado se instala XAMPP1.8 y se activa el servicio de apache. Codificación La codificación se lleva a cabo por parejas y se hace un CRUD (lis- tar, registrar, actualizar, eliminar) con PHP en las pantallas de registro de libro, registro de pago, registro de elaboradores, registro de estados. Pruebas Se realizan las pruebas de funcionalidad para saber si el sistema de administración de la Notaria Número 15 presenta algunos errores, con la finalidad de eliminarlos. Una vez que se realizaron las pruebas al sistema y se corroboró que no hubiese detalles y dudas con respecto a la funcionalidad, se procedió a dejar instalado el sistema de ingeniería del software, algunas de las pantallas del sistema de administración de la Notaria Número 15 se presentan en la siguiente sección. Implementación del proyecto El usuario es una parte más del equipo de desarrollo; su presencia es indispensable en las distintas fases de la metodología XP. A la hora de 82 Revista Científica codificar una aplicación, la presencia del usuario es aún más necesaria. En esta fase de la codificación los clientes y los desarrolladores del pro- yecto deben estar en comunicación para que los desarrolladores puedan codificar todo lo necesario para el proyecto que se requiere, en esta fase está incluida la codificación o programación por parte de los de- sarrolladores del proyecto. Uno de los pilares de la metodología XP es el uso de test para comprobar el funcionamiento de los códigos que se implementen. Dado los resultados preliminares que el prototipo dejó, se continuó con el desarrollo y mejoramiento de la aplicación, haciendo los cambios necesarios para que el prototipo fuera evolucionando a la aplicación web como tal. Esto tomó un poco más de tiempo, se presentó de nuevo al usuario, para que lo revisara y lo aprobara, el cual dio por bueno, solo con algunos cambios mínimos. Cuando se introduce una nueva tecnología exitosa, el concepto ini- cial se mueve a través de un “ciclo de vida de innovación”, Kurzweil sugiere que, dentro de 20 años, la evolución tecnológica acelerará a un ritmo cada vez más rápido, lo que al final conducirá a una era de inteli- gencia no biológica que se fusionará con la inteligencia humana en for- mas que son fascinantes de imaginar. Por ello, al momento de instalar el sistema fue de gran innovación para la Notaría Número 15, debido a que con este sistema se obtendría un mejor control de las actividades que se realizan en la empresa. Al momento que el usuario desea ejecutar el sistema para ser utili- zado (Figura 2) se aprecia el mensaje de bienvenida al sistema de la notaria, indicando con ello que se cargan todas las bibliotecas necesa- rias para ponerse en marcha.